GIRLING HEALTH SYSTEMS, INC. v. U.S.

No. 91-5043.

949 F.2d 1145 (1991)

GIRLING HEALTH SYSTEMS, INC., Plaintiff-Appellant, v. The UNITED STATES, Defendant-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als, Federal Circuit.

November 22,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ael J. Christianson, Law offices of Michael J. Christianson, Inc., Newport Beach, Cal., argued for plaintiff-appellant.

Bridget M. Rowan, Atty., Dept. of Justice, Washington, D.C., argued for defendant-appellee. With her on the brief were Shirley D. Peterson, Asst. Atty. Gen., Gary R. Allen and William S. Estabrook, Attys.

Before ARCHER, MICHEL and PLAGER, Circuit Judges.


OPINION

ARCHER, Circuit Judge.

Girling Health Systems, Inc. (Girling) appeals the November 20, 1990 order of the United States Claims Court, 22 Cl.Ct. 66, No. 372-89 T, dismissing Girling's action for lack of subject matter jurisdiction. We affirm.
